🎨 How to color it

Give number 7’s jersey a bold teal, the volleyball warm yellow and white panels, the net tape deep navy, and the far scoreboard pale gray with orange numbers. Use sharp colored pencils for the net squares and jersey folds, then switch to smooth marker fills on the larger shorts and court areas. Try a secret-light effect by shading the ball’s lower panels slightly darker, as if it has just passed under the gym lights.

Under the humming gym lights, Maris pressed a stub of blue chalk into her palm and drew three tiny marks on her wristband: dot, dash, dot. She had invented Chalk-Code, a game where each mark told her what kind of set to make before the ball arrived. From her usual spot near the back wall, the plan felt clever. But the code would only count if she tried it at the net, where the air smelled like rubber soles and floor polish, and every shoe squeak sounded like a warning.

She jogged forward, losing the chalk stub from her pocket. It skittered under the padding with a soft tick. Small price, Maris thought, though her hands felt empty without it. “Dot, dash, dot,” she whispered. When the pass rose, she lifted her fingers and saw, high above the net, three old chalk scratches on a roof beam—dot, dash, dot—left by somebody who had played a secret game before her.

Maris set the ball cleanly, not to win a point, but to send her handmade code into the air. Later, she made new marks on a scrap of tape and tucked it inside her shoe. If you catch number 7 looking up, maybe you can guess which beam answered: dot, dash, dot.
